FIGHTING OVER GUARD SCREEN-INS & CONVERSION OFFENSE:

Zone defense gets a bad rap by a lot of coaches. It’s true, veteran coaches will carve a suspect zone defense up. However, fundamentally solid zone defenses can be a game changer. As with effective man-to-man defenses, it takes a lot of critical redundancy to make a zone defense effective. A few of our most important aspects of our 23-Zone:
- Moving on air time when sliding
- Contesting
- Avoiding screen-ins
- Bumping effectively
- On-Ball-Defense
- Off-Ball-Stance
- Off-Ball positioning
- Blocking out & Rebounding
In this clip, Dominique King (#35) fights over a guard screen-in properly, stays above the screener & uses his screen-side lead leg to fight over the screen-in. This leads to a steal & quick conversion to offense where Austin Nowak (#11) makes an outstanding offensive move & shot.
